Summarising the physical % complete is currently an enhancement request that Primavera are looking into. They have a workaround on the knowledgebase (bulletin # prim11292), but one of the conditions is having costs assigned to the activities.

From the bulletin...
"At the summary level, the Performance % complete is calculated as follows:
Performance % Complete = (BCWP * 100) / BAC
(Where the BCWP is the Budgeted Cost of Work Performed and the BAC is the Budget At Completion)
BCWP is calculated as Activity % Complete * Baseline Total Cost"
